Hinomaru Ramen 8.5
Astoria (North)-Ditmars-Steinway
Hinomaru Ramen is a dedicated ramen-ya on Ditmars Boulevard known for its long-simmered Hakata-style pork bone broths and a focused menu of hearty bowls. Regulars come for the signature Hinomaru (New York Style) and Tonkotsu Shoyu ramen, plus a handful of small plates that make it a reliable noodle stop for both locals and destination ramen hunters.
Must-Try Dishes: Hinomaru (New York Style) ramen, Tonkotsu Shoyu ramen, Lemongrass chicken
